    Dr. Nasiru Sani Gwarzo: A Life of Service and Impact

    EditorBy EditorFebruary 8, 2025Updated:February 8, 2025No Comments3 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Telegram WhatsApp
    IMG 20250202 WA0072

    Kabiru Haruna

    Dr. Nasiru Sani Gwarzo is not just a public servant, he is a man deeply committed to making a real difference in people’s lives.

    As the Permanent Secretary of the Federal Ministry of Education, his work goes beyond policies and paperwork; it’s about shaping the future of education, breaking barriers, and ensuring that no one is left behind.

    One of the things that truly sets Dr. Gwarzo apart is his commitment to inclusivity, especially within the education sector.

    He made history as the first Permanent Secretary in Nigeria to appoint a visually impaired person as his executive assistant an inspiring move that challenges the way people with disabilities are viewed in the workplace.

    His efforts have not gone unnoticed.

    He was honored as a Disability Rights Ambassador by the National Commission for Persons with Disabilities, a recognition that reflects his passion for making society and education more inclusive and accessible for all.

    Beyond his role in government, Dr. Gwarzo is a medical doctor, researcher, and public health expert.

    His work has taken him across countries, leading vaccination efforts and responding to humanitarian crises.

    He understands, on a very human level, what it means to serve people in their most vulnerable moments.

    His vast experience in public health has influenced his approach to education, emphasizing the importance of health-friendly schools, child well-being, and policies that promote both learning and health.

    As Permanent Secretary, Dr. Gwarzo has worked tirelessly to enhance Nigeria’s education system. His leadership has focused on:

    Promoting quality education for all, ensuring that children from all backgrounds have access to learning opportunities.

    Advocating for teacher training and welfare, recognizing that well-trained and well-supported educators are key to national development.

    Encouraging educational reforms that align with modern technological advancements, preparing Nigerian students for the future.

    Strengthening school infrastructure and accessibility, making education more inclusive for students with disabilities.

    At his core, Dr. Gwarzo is a man driven by a sense of duty to humanity. His leadership isn’t about titles or recognition it’s about creating real, lasting change.

    By pushing for inclusive education, advocating for teachers, and using his expertise to improve the education sector, he is leaving behind a legacy that will continue to inspire and uplift others.
